Best season: fall. Fall offers the clearest skies, the lowest bug and fire risk, and crisp daytime hiking weather — typically daytime highs in the 50s–70°F (10–21°C) with cool nights dipping into the 20s–40°F (-6–4°C). Trails around Lassen Volcanic National Park are at their most accessible and scenic, fishing picks up as waters cool, and wildlife activity (deer, birds) increases while visitor crowds thin compared with midsummer. Battle Creek Campground features 50 designated sites with amenities including grills and picnic tables at each site. Flush toilets are available, and potable water is provided. Firewood can be purchased on-site. The campground is located near Lassen Volcanic National Park, making it a great base for exploring its diverse trails and natural features.
